Solution

The correct option is C (iii) and (iv)
A substance is termed amphoteric if it can show both, the acidic and basic behaviour Water is an amphoteric substance. It has the ability to act as an acid as well as a base. With NH3 (which is a base) it acts as an acid.
NH3+H2ONH4OH
It act as a base with H2S which is bronsted acid.
HCl+H2OCl+H3O+
